Connections and Setup Chapter 1
Plug in the TV
Plug the end of the power cord into the back of the TV. Plug the other end into an outlet, inserting the
plug completely. Do not plug the TV into an outlet controlled by a light switch.

Turn on the TV
Turn on your TV by pressing the Power button ( )onthesideoftheTVortheON•OFFbuttononthe
remote control.
Using the Remote Control to Complete
Initial Setup
You will need to use the remote control to complete the setup of your TV. The remote control allows you
to navigate through and select items that appear in the on-screen menus. The process works the same
on all menu screens: highlight your choice and select it.
To select a menu item, press the arrows to highlight one of the items listed on the screen. Use the up or
down arrows to move up or down. Use the right or left arrows to view other selections for a menu choice
or to display a sub-menu.
Note: Highlighted items
stand out from other
menu items on the list
(appear darker, brighter,
or a different color).
